Trouble with solenoids?

Hi, we had our solenoids programmed but mechanical switched some things around and now, there are only two first-time programmers (myself and another student) who are trying to figure this out (our mentors have gone AWOL >:I). What exactly does true/false mean when programming? And one of the solenoids needs to move a lever forward and backwards, how would we go about doing this? Help is GREATLY appreciated.

Re: Trouble with solenoids?

Normally there would be two solenoids, one for extend and one for retract. If you wanted to extend, you would set the extend one to true and the retract one to false. If you wanted to retract, you would set the retract one to true and the extend one to false
